Pure List

Pure List

Pure List is a simple, clean to-do list and task manager app. It has an intuitive and distraction-free interface to help you focus on getting things done. Key features include multiple lists, reminders, notes, and cloud sync across devices.

Tomboy

Tomboy

Tomboy is a free, open-source note-taking and information organizing software application. It has a simple interface for creating, editing, and searching notes, allowing users to easily capture ideas, to-do lists, notes, and more on their desktop.
